One of the most captivating aspects of this region is its architectural heritage, particularly the Early American style homes that grace the area. These charming residences reflect the timeless elegance and craftsmanship of a bygone era, characterized by their symmetrical facades, gabled roofs, and classic wooden details. The Early American architectural style not only adds character to the neighborhood but also serves as a reminder of the rich history that defines Rains County.
